Fourth time here and the food is always great, I usually get carne asada tacos but the last two times I've gotten the birria tacos which is an off menu item that you have to ask for. Highly recommend. The wait staff is always great and attentive. I've never encountered a wait to be seate but I have passed by one time and there was a line out the door. The inside is decorated with, murals representing Hispanic culture.
